How to Select a Stored Waveform

(1)

Enter the operation menu: Press

→Editable Wform →Select Wform.

(2)

Enter the storage path of the desired waveform file. Turn the knob or press

/

direction key to select the desired waveform file.

(3)

Choose Recall output.

How to Edit a Stored Waveform

(1)

Enter the operation menu: Press

→Editable Wform →Edit Wform.

(2)

Enter the storage path of the desired waveform file. Turn the knob or press

/

direction key to select the desired waveform file.

(3)

Choose Recall suppress.

How to Delete a Stored Waveform

(1)

Press Save function button to enter the file system.

(2)

Enter the storage path of the desired waveform file. Turn the knob or press

/

direction key to select the desired waveform file.

(3)

Choose Delete.

To Generate the Modulated Waveform

Use the Mod button to generate modulated waveform. This series can modulate
waveform using AM, FM, PM, FSK and PWM. To turn off the modulation, press the Mod
button.

AM (Amplitude Modulation)

The modulated waveform consists of two parts: the Carrier Waveform and the
Modulating Waveform. The Carrier Waveform can only be Sine. In AM, the amplitude of
the Carrier Waveform varies with the instantaneous voltage of the modulating waveform.
